Electrical current in the staterooms is 110 volts AC and is capable of handling all normal appliances such as electric razors, hair dryers, and hot curlers. However, some appliances may require use of an adapter. Will Internet access be available? The ship has an infirmary staffed by one or more doctors and two to four nurses who are on call around the clock. The infirmary staff will assist you and provide medical attention during your cruise, including dispensing prescriptions, should the need arise. There is a fee for the doctor's visit, as well as for any prescription drugs. If you should contract a contagious disease, or even suspect a contagious disease, it's compulsory that you report it to the ship's doctor for the safety of everyone onboard. Will I get seasick? Seasickness is very rare on ships as large as Carnival's. The ship is equipped with stabilizers, which are designed to keep them smooth and steady in the water. If you should feel queasy, medicine is available from your cabin steward, the Information Desk, or the infirmary. U.S. citizens United States citizens must present proof of citizenship in the form of a passport (valid or expired for less than 10 years), original birth certificate, state-issued certified copy of a birth certificate from the Department of Health and Vital Statistics, U.S. Military ID (no dependent IDs), or original Naturalization papers. In addition to the above requirements, all guests 16 years of age or older must provide an official photo ID. It is important that guest names on travel documents (passport, Alien Resident Card, birth certificates, etc.) be identical to those on the cruise and airlines tickets. Otherwise, proof of name change (i.e., a marriage license) OR a valid driver's license or government-issued photo ID (i.e., U.S. Military ID) must be presented. Non-U.S. citizens U.S. Resident Aliens need a valid Alien Resident Card. Canadian citizens must present a valid passport, original birth certificate, or certified copy of a birth certificate. Non-U.S. citizens need a valid passport and a valid, unexpired U.S. Multiple Re-entry Visa, if applicable. Non-U.S. citizens eligible to apply for admission under the Visa Waiver Pilot Program must still have a valid, unexpired passport. What else do I need to know about baggage?
